What are my cheap ticket options for Crossmyloof to Sandbach journeys?

From booking in Advance, to our FairSplits, here are our tips for you to find the best price

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Crossmyloof to Sandbach start from as little as £15.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Crossmyloof to Sandbach start from £97.90 one way, or £139.90 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Crossmyloof to Sandbach are available for £102.10 one way, or £204.20 return

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Facilities and Amenities

Even though Crossmyloof Station lacks a ticket office, don't fret. Ticket machines are available that are accessible and allow for the pickup of tickets purchased online. While it might not have a range of shops or refreshment outlets, basic amenities like a seating area are present. With no toilets or baby-changing facilities, planning ahead is recommended. Despite the absence of an actual waiting room, the area provides a comfortable seating space.

For passengers requiring extra support, an induction loop is available, and step-free access to both platforms makes it relatively accessible. However, travelers should be cautious of the stepping distance between the train and the platform. For those cycling around, there are ten bicycle storage spaces, though they are unsheltered and not under CCTV surveillance.

Onward Travel from Crossmyloof

Whether you're journeying further afield or exploring locally, Crossmyloof offers several transport links. Taxis can be found via TrainTaxi, and for those transitioning between rail services and buses, local services pick up at convenient locations nearby. Rail replacement buses to Glasgow Central are conveniently accessible from Titwood Road—directions can be pinpointed via What3words.

Facilities and Amenities at Sandbach Station

Despite its small size, Sandbach Train Station offers a variety of facilities to ensure a convenient travel experience. The station features a ticket office open from Monday to Saturday, with ticket machines available for those who prefer quick service or need to collect tickets purchased online. Accessibility is a priority here, with induction loops, step-free access to certain areas, and accessible ticket machines to assist passengers with limited mobility. However, there are some limitations, such as the absence of public Wi-Fi, cashpoints, and refreshment facilities. Travellers will also find no waiting rooms or toilets at the station, so it's advisable to plan accordingly before embarking on your journey.

Onward Travel Options

For those looking to venture beyond the station, travel links from Sandbach connect you seamlessly to other transport modes. Positioned at the front of the station, a rail replacement service departs during times of disruption, ensuring continuity in travel plans. For those preferring road transport, taxis can be booked through platforms like Northern Railway's Cab4You service. Buses serve local routes to Middlewich, Winsford, and Sandbach town centre, with convenient stops just 100 yards away on London Road.
